The Importance of Preventive Maintenance for Car Owners

Though numerous car owners may overlook preventive maintenance, prioritizing it can substantially decrease long-term costs and boost vehicle performance. Regular service checks, like oil changes, tire rotations, and fluid level inspections, work to increase the lifespan of a vehicle. By handling little issues before they become major repairs, car owners can evade the financial burden of costly damage.

Additionally, a properly maintained vehicle runs more efficiently, resulting in better fuel efficiency and reduced emissions. This not only reduces money at the pump but also helps the environment.

In addition, routine upkeep can boost the complete safety of the vehicle, as it guarantees critical components function appropriately. Eventually, allocating funds for routine maintenance fosters peace of mind, knowing the vehicle is unlikely to experience unexpected breakdowns. Automobile owners who embrace preventive maintenance not only experience better performance but also protect their investment against potential repair costs.

How Routine Inspections Identify Hidden Problems

Regular vehicle inspections are crucial for early problem detection for vehicles. By identifying issues before they escalate, car owners can prevent costly repairs down the line. This proactive approach not only extends vehicle longevity but also generates significant savings.

Early Issue Identification

When automobiles experience regular checkups, hidden defects commonly emerge before they turn into pricey repairs. Swift issue detection is a primary benefit of scheduled appointments to an automotive mechanic. During these inspections, mechanics analyze several elements, such as brakes, tires, and fluid levels, spotting degradation that may not be readily visible to the owner. This anticipatory strategy enables the discovery of emerging issues, such as leaks or unusual noises, which can indicate hidden problems. By managing these concerns without delay, vehicle owners can preserve maximum efficiency and safety. Eventually, regular inspections not only increase vehicle longevity but also give peace of mind, knowing that little concerns are addressed before they develop into significant complications.

Costly Repair Prevention

Scheduled inspections not only allow for early problem detection but also play a pivotal role in preventing costly repairs. By regularly examining vehicle components, mechanics can discover hidden issues such as deteriorated brake pads, fluid leaks, or engine irregularities before they escalate. These outwardly minor problems, if left neglected, can trigger major failures requiring significant repairs or even complete replacements. For instance, a small coolant leak could cause an overheated engine, costing thousands in damage. Consistent visits to an auto mechanic empower vehicle owners to address these concerns proactively, ultimately preserving money and extending the vehicle's lifespan. Committing to routine inspections is a sensible decision that shields against unexpected expenses and boosts overall vehicle reliability.

The Expense of Overlooking Preventive Maintenance and Minor Repairs

Ignoring preventive maintenance and minor repairs can bring about major long-term financial burdens for vehicle owners. When minor problems, such as worn brake pads or a small fluid leak, are neglected, they can turn into significantly worse problems. For instance, disregarding a simple oil change can bring about engine wear, in the end demanding an expensive replacement. Furthermore, failing to address minor electrical problems may lead to complete system failures, costing significantly more than the initial repair would have.

Routine appointments with an auto mechanic enable prompt actions that avoid these expensive failures. Automobile proprietors could realize that the combined costs of deferred servicing substantially outweigh the charges connected with preventive maintenance. Additionally, disregarding these matters can likewise lower the automobile's resale price, causing owners to possess a depreciated property. In the long run, proactive maintenance not only enhances vehicle longevity but also safeguards the owner's financial investment.

Why Regular Oil Changes Save You Money

Consistent oil changes play an essential role in preserving engine health and longevity. By ensuring optimal lubrication, they enhance fuel efficiency and decrease the likelihood of costly repairs down the road. In the end, these regular services result in considerable long-term savings for vehicle owners.

Longevity Benefits for Your Engine

Even though some vehicle owners may disregard oil changes as a routine maintenance task, these routine services play a critical role in improving engine longevity. Scheduled oil changes ensure that the engine is well-lubricated, reducing friction and wear on its moving parts. Clean oil efficiently eliminates contaminants that can gather over time, inhibiting sludge buildup and potential engine damage. By maintaining proper oil levels and quality, vehicle owners can avert overheating and excessive wear, producing a more durable engine. In addition, a well-maintained engine functions more smoothly, reducing the likelihood of costly repairs. In the long run, investing in regular oil changes becomes a wise choice, as it extends engine life and lessens the risk of unexpected expenses associated with engine failure.

Enhanced Fuel Performance

By prioritizing timely oil changes, vehicle owners frequently see better gas mileage, resulting in substantial cost reductions at the pump. Clean oil minimizes friction between engine components, enabling the engine to function more smoothly. This optimal performance can result in a notable increase in miles per gallon (MPG). Additionally, clean oil aids in regulating engine temperature, preventing overheating and ensuring that the vehicle runs efficiently. Skipping oil changes can result in dirty, degraded oil, which can compromise engine performance and decrease fuel economy. By sticking to a regular oil change schedule, vehicle owners not only enhance their automobile's performance and also reduce the frequency of refueling, eventually resulting in lower fuel expenses over time.

Proactive Maintenance Financial Benefits

Prompt oil changes contribute greatly to overall vehicle maintenance, leading to substantial savings in the long run. Consistently replacing the oil verifies that the engine functions smoothly and efficiently, reducing wear and tear on its components. This practice assists in preventing costly repairs that may occur due to neglect. In addition, clean oil increases fuel efficiency, enabling drivers to save on gas expenses. Most manufacturers advise oil changes at specific intervals, and complying with these guidelines can increase the vehicle's lifespan. By maintaining regular oil changes, vehicle owners not only preserve optimal performance but also reduce the risk of unexpected breakdowns. As a result, these preventive measures can produce significant financial benefits over time, making regular visits to the mechanic a wise choice.

How Maintaining Your Tires Helps You Save Money

Correct tire upkeep is vital for vehicle owners aiming to save money in the long run. Properly maintained tires boost fuel efficiency by providing optimal traction and reducing rolling resistance. When tires are adequately inflated and aligned, vehicles consume less fuel, resulting in lower gas expenses over time.

In addition, regular tire rotations and alignments can greatly extend tire durability, delaying the need for expensive replacements. Irregular wear can bring about premature tire failure, leading to unexpected expenses and potential risks on the road.

Investing in tires with proper tread depth not only improves performance and reduces the risk of accidents. Drivers who neglect their tires may face not only elevated fuel costs but also expenses tied to repairs stemming from tire-related issues.

Why Regular Check-Ups Enhance Vehicle Safety

Routine examinations are vital for ensuring vehicle safety, as they enable the early detection of potential issues that could trigger accidents. These inspections typically cover vital components such as brakes, steering, and lights, which play a major part in safe driving. Mechanics can discover damaged parts, leaks, or other malfunctions that, if left unchecked, may jeopardize vehicle performance.

Moreover, consistent maintenance helps verify that safety features, such as seat belts and airbags, are functioning correctly. This proactive approach decreases the chance of mechanical failure while driving, increasing overall road safety for both the driver and other road users. Furthermore, routine checks contribute to maintaining visibility by checking that headlights and taillights are operational, which is essential during nighttime or adverse weather conditions. Ultimately, regular check-ups not only promote safer driving experiences but also promote long-term vehicle reliability.

How Routine Visits Prolong Your Vehicle's Lifespan

When automobile owners focus on routine maintenance appointments, they substantially increase their car's longevity. Regular check-ups allow mechanics to identify and address minor issues before they develop into major problems. For instance, timely oil changes, fluid assessments, and tire rotations prevent wear and tear that could bring about engine failure or diminished performance.

Furthermore, regular inspections help keep vital systems, including brakes and suspension, making sure they function effectively. This not only increases the vehicle's longevity but also enhances fuel consumption, resulting in extra cost savings.

Additionally, a regularly serviced vehicle keeps its resale value far better than one that has been neglected. Potential buyers often prefer cars with comprehensive maintenance records, making them more desirable in the used car market. In conclusion, regular visits to an auto mechanic support a vehicle's complete health, making sure it remains reliable and efficient for years to come.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Often Should I Schedule Visits to My Auto Mechanic?

Normally, setting up appointments to an auto mechanic every 6 months or 5,000 miles is wise. Nevertheless, particular vehicle needs and usage may demand adjustments, making it important to consult the vehicle's maintenance guidelines for specifics.

What Should I Anticipate During a Regular Vehicle Inspection?

Throughout a regular vehicle examination, one can expect checks on fluid levels, brakes, tires, lights, and belts. Service professionals can offer a report outlining any necessary repairs or maintenance, ensuring the vehicle remains operational and safe.

Are There Certain Symptoms That Show I Need to Consult a Mechanic?

Certain signs indicate a need for a mechanic, including strange noises, warning lights on the dashboard, fluid leaks, poor performance, or strange odors. Dealing with these concerns immediately can stop more extensive and costly repairs later.

What Documentation Should I Maintain From My Auto Repair Appointments?

Preserving records of services rendered, parts replaced, and repairs carried out is crucial. Moreover, maintaining invoices and warranties increases transparency and aids future maintenance decisions, ultimately contributing to knowledgeable vehicle care and improved resale prospects.
